Meopham questions, answered
How fast is the turnaround for Meopham properties?
You do not turn linen around on the day — you hold a set ahead. A 10am checkout and a 3pm check-in leaves about five hours. No laundry can do that reliably, ours included, and any supplier who says otherwise is describing a good week.
- Three sets per bed — one on the bed, one with us, one on the shelf — means the clean set is already in the Meopham property before the guest has left. The changeover stops depending on us, or on a machine, or on the traffic.
- Collections and drops happen on the same visit, so there is no second trip and no window where a bed sits stripped waiting for a delivery.
- a 30.8-mile plant distance is what makes a same-day recovery possible if a run is disrupted — the fix is hours away, not days.
- The spare set is what protects the booking, which is exactly why the third one is not optional however tight the budget looks.

What par level do you recommend for Meopham?
Three, per bed, every time. Two is the number most Meopham hosts start with and the number that fails them on the first busy fortnight.
- Two sets fails on a back-to-back. A Friday-to-Sunday followed by a Sunday-to-Wednesday leaves you short on the Sunday.
- A sofa bed counts as a bed — it turns as often as the others and is left off almost every list we are given.
- Towels turn faster than bed linen. They are the item that runs out first and the one nobody counts.
- Reviewed after a month of real occupancy in Meopham and adjusted at no charge. Seasonal swing is expected and the level should move with it.
